Range and Capability of Press Capacities from 11 MN to 125 MN

Large aluminum extrusion manufacturers rely on the broad range of press capacities to accommodate diverse production scales and alloy types within a single facility. Presses with capacities stretching from 11 MN up to 125 MN serve as the backbone of extrusion line solutions, allowing the shaping of various aluminum profiles from lightweight components to heavy structural elements. This range supports manufacturers in handling everything from simple billet extrusion to highly demanding, complex shapes without compromising cycle times or quality. The scalability inherent in the system gives manufacturers agility, enabling them to quickly adjust to different product runs or project needs. Integrating these presses within an automated extrusion production line further streamlines operations by linking billet loading, heating furnaces, and downstream processes like pulling and cutting, minimizing downtime. This harmonization of capacity and automation enhances throughput consistency and supports large-scale manufacturing projects where precision and speed are paramount.

 

Integration of Automation and Control in Aluminum Extrusion Press Operations

Automation is transforming how extrusion line solutions operate, particularly within the frameworks favored by large aluminum extrusion manufacturers. Modern aluminum extrusion extrusion line solutions leverage sophisticated automation and control systems that monitor and regulate every stage of the process in real time. This integration allows fine-tuned adjustments to billet temperature, press speed, and extrusion force, ensuring uniformity across all output and reducing human error. The automated extrusion production line includes smart diagnostics, enabling predictive maintenance and minimizing unexpected stoppages. Moreover, energy management systems embedded in these solutions monitor consumption patterns, which helps optimize power usage and dramatically lowers operational costs. The connectivity in these lines also supports remote access and centralized control, meaning operators can manage and troubleshoot processes without being physically present on the factory floor. Such automation elevates product quality while empowering manufacturers with comprehensive process visibility, enhancing both productivity and asset longevity.

 

Enhancing Throughput and Product Consistency with Advanced Extrusion Press Technology

Efficiency and repeatability are essential to delivering high volumes with consistent quality, particularly for manufacturers employing aluminum extrusion extrusion line solutions. Advanced extrusion press technology, combined with an automated extrusion production line setup, improves throughput by synchronizing material flow from billet preparation to finished profile handling. Components like cooling systems, pullers, cutting equipment, and stacking units work in concert under automated control to maintain a smooth, continuous process that reduces bottlenecks and production variances. This optimized synchronization supports large aluminum extrusion manufacturers in maximizing operational tempo without sacrificing the dimensional accuracy or surface finish of extruded components. Modular designs within these solutions also allow flexible reconfiguration of the line to adapt quickly to production shifts or new product launches while preserving consistent output standards.
